Output 331da2894cedf5de0b8cc3ea2d79274581dffec14654dc44f96732a8e626eabd:0

value
151676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36fe8e942a0eff3ad1cac827a75dedaad15358d1 OP_EQUAL
address
36hoMq4UsjFBQrB7NZkycRVPqvUTjRQn9Q
transaction
331da2894cedf5de0b8cc3ea2d79274581dffec14654dc44f96732a8e626eabd
confirmations
135793
spent
true